Joseph "Joe" Duane Shelton, 81, of Bloomington passed away peacefully on Wednesday, November 13, 2024 at IU Health University Hospital in Indianapolis. He was born on March 5, 1943 in Bloomington, Indiana the son of Theodore and Violet (Harp) Shelton.
Joe was a graduate of Bloomington High School South class of 1961. He was a Sergeant in the United States Marine Corp serving from 1963-1968 during the Vietnam War. Joe married the love of his life Frances Louise Garvin on March 15, 1969 in Bloomington. He served with the Indiana Army National Guard from1982-2003 retiring as Command Sergeant Major with the 38th Division Artillery. He was a machinist for NSA Crane retiring after 30 years.
Joe was a member of Central Wesleyan Church for 50 years and attended Bloomington Eastview Church of the Nazarene. He was a member of the American Legion post 18 and VFW post 604. Joe loved singing gospel at local churches and going out to eat with friends. He enjoyed riding his motorcycle, reading, fishing, driving long distance trips, and sitting on his front porch swing.
Joe is survived by his loving wife of 55 years, Louise Shelton; four children, Robert Wright, Bradley Shelton, Sandra Davis and Becca Collier; two brothers, John Shelton and Paul Shelton; sister, Tina Blackwell; eight grandchildren, thirteen great grandchildren, and several nieces and nephews.
He was preceded in death by his parents, daughter Debbie Arnett and a sister Janice Copenhaver.
